{"data":{"id":"us/40-cfr-792.47","jurisdiction":"us","citation":"40 CFR 792.47","heading":"Facilities for handling test, control, and reference substances.","body":"(a) As necessary to prevent contamination or mixups, there shall be separate areas for:\n(1) Receipt and storage of the test, control, and reference substances.\n(2) Mixing of the test, control, and reference substances with a carrier, e.g., feed.\n(3) Storage of the test, control, and reference substance mixtures.\n(b) Storage areas for test, control, and/or reference substance and for test, control, and/or reference mixtures shall be separate from areas housing the test systems and shall be adequate to preserve the identity, strength, purity, and stability of the substances and mixtures.","path":["Title 40—Protection of Environment","CHAPTER I—ENVIRONMENTAL PROTECTION AGENCY","SUBCHAPTER R—TOXIC SUBSTANCES CONTROL ACT","PART 792—GOOD LABORATORY PRACTICE STANDARDS","Subpart C—Facilities"],"source_url":"https://www.ecfr.gov/api/versioner/v1/full/2026-08-25/title-40.xml","current_through":"2026-08-25","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-08-27T02:26:04Z","sha256":"dd227f0966b11a75682fc5f90932552d0159d6758732c3fa6f9319caa5d65692","source_id":"us-cfr","stale":true,"prev":"us/40-cfr-792.45","next":"us/40-cfr-792.49"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
